The lowest level is Level 1, the highest Level 5.
C) headlight
When the display is on, the default mode is Level
D) on/off
1. When there is no numeric mode display, there
E) mode
is no power assistance.
3 Switch between Distance Mode and Speed
Mode
Briefly press i to switch between distance and
speed. Single-trip distance (TRIP km) / total
distance (TOTAL km) / maximum speed (MAXS
km/h) / average riding speed (AVG km/h) are
displayed in successive order.
4 Headlight/ Display Backlight Switch
Press
for 2 seconds. The backlight of the
display as well as the headlight and taillight
will be turned on. Press
to power off the display backlight/headlight/
taillight. (If the display is turned on in a dark
environment, the display backlight/ headlight/
taillight will be turned on automatically. If the
display backlight/headlight/taillight are turned
off manually, they also need to be turned on
manually afterwards). There are 5 levels of back-
light brightness that can be selected by the user.
5 Walk Assistance
Press – for 2 seconds. The e-bike enters the
walk assistance mode, and the symbol WALK is
displayed. Once the key – is released, the e-bike
will exit the walk assistance mode.
6 Battery Status Indication
When the battery status is normal, a certain
number of the battery LCD segments as well
as the border light up according to the actual
quantity of charge. If all of the 10 segments will
black out with the border blinking, the battery
needs to be charged immediately.
